Symptoms

  • •Vibration felt through the steering wheel or floorboard
  • •Increased noise at higher speeds
  • •Steering wheel may shake or become unstable
  • •Uneven tire wear observed
  • •Potential loss of control during acceleration

Solution
1. Preparation
  • Gather necessary tools and materials.
  • Park the vehicle on a level surface and engage the parking brake.
  • Wear safety gloves and goggles.
2. Inspect and Inflate Tires
  • Sub-steps:
    • Remove the wheel covers if necessary.
    • Check tire pressure with a tire gauge and inflate to the recommended PSI found in the owner’s manual.
    • Inspect tires for uneven wear, bubbles, or damage.
  • Tools Required: Tire pressure gauge, air compressor.
3. Wheel Balancing
  • Sub-steps:
    • Remove the wheel and tire assembly from the vehicle.
    • Use a wheel balancing machine to check for imbalances.
    • Attach balancing weights as needed based on the machine's readings.
    • Reinstall the wheel and torque the lug nuts to the manufacturer’s specifications.
  • Tools Required: Wheel balancing machine, torque wrench.
4. Wheel Alignment
  • Sub-steps:
    • Take the vehicle to an alignment shop or use an alignment tool.
    • Adjust the camber, caster, and toe settings to meet manufacturer specifications.
  • Tools Required: Alignment tool (if DIY).
5. Inspect and Replace Suspension Components
  • Sub-steps:
    • Visually inspect struts, shocks, and bushings for signs of wear or damage.
    • If worn, replace with OEM or quality aftermarket parts.
    • Ensure all components are properly torqued to specifications.
  • Tools Required: Socket set, torque wrench.
6. Inspect Drivetrain Components
  • Sub-steps:
    • Check the CV joints and driveshaft for any signs of wear or damage.
    • Replace any faulty components as necessary.
    • Test all components after replacement to ensure proper function.
  • Tools Required: Socket set, pry bar.
